## Changelog — Inkwheel v3.2

Renamed `MD_RENDER_TOKEN` to `INKWHEEL_PIPELINE_SECRET`. The old name implied a per-user token; it is a service-level secret for the sanitizer callback. No fallback — update all envs before merge. CI will fail on the old name. Set the new variable in your env file on the next line:

sealed setting: ARCHIVE_KEY3=8d0

TURN-208: Gatevale turnstile counters at the Merrow Field pilot double-count when a rotation reverses mid-cycle. Attendance totals drift roughly 2% high per event. The debounce window fix is implemented, reviewed by Ilsa, and soak-tested across two simulated match days without drift. Ready for your cut; the candidate build is identified below.

trace token, tagag-tafog: htk6_5ed18c

Minutes — Management Meeting, Project Larkspur

Present: heads of department. Larkspur migration slips six weeks; vendor integration testing incomplete. Tomas Reale to re-baseline the plan by Friday. Budget impact estimated at 4%, absorbed within contingency. Comms to staff held until new dates confirmed. No further slippage tolerated. The confidential note on dependent business plans follows immediately below.

board note of fafog-yahap: Project Rusdor slips by a full year because of the audit delay.

Handing off the Quillbus broker upgrade (4.x to 5.1) to Dario. Cluster is half-migrated; mixed-version mode is supported but TLS cert rotation must finish before cutover. No auth model changes, though the admin API gained two new endpoints worth reviewing. Open questions and the migration checklist are tracked on the internal page below.

dashboard of taduf-bawef = https://jira.lumicsys.internal/projects/display/browse/b1cbf89d